RCA Victor EPBT-3005 (7-in. 45-rpm double-faced (Extended play))
The following matrix(es) were released with this catalog number:
Company | Matrix No. | Take Number | Date | Title/Artist |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Victor | BS-060348 | 1 | 1/20/1941 | For you / Jo Stafford ; Tommy Dorsey Orchestra | |
Victor | BS-060349 | 2 | 1/20/1941 | Without a song / Frank Sinatra ; Tommy Dorsey Orchestra | |
Victor | PBS-061989 | 1 | 12/22/1941 | What is this thing called love? / Connie Haines ; Tommy Dorsey Orchestra |
Primary Performers:
Tommy Dorsey Orchestra (Musical group) |
Jo Stafford (vocalist) |
Frank Sinatra (vocalist) |
Connie Haines (vocalist) |
